DAY 1, 2 & 3: USA - SINGAPORE
We cross the international dateline en route to
Singapore. Upon arrival we will be transferred to
our hotel for a good night’s rest. Singapore, the
“Lion City” is a modern city on a lush, tropical
island. This single island, only 255 square miles in
size, is nevertheless, rich in history and culture.
Colonized in 1819 by Sir Stamford Raffles, it has
become one of the world’s largest ports. Its
geography and thriving economy have attracted
immigrants from every continent. Today its
population of 2.7 million is the “melting pot” of
the Orient - hosting a mixture of Chinese,
Malaysians, Indians, Pakistanis, Singhalese, British
and Americans. English is the preferred language
linking each of these ethnic groups. Dinner tonight
will be at our hotel. (Inflight meals,D)
DAY 4: SINGAPORE
This morning enjoy a city sightseeing tour of
Singapore including visits to Raffles Place, the
waterfront, Sri Mariamman Hindu Temple, the colorful
Chinatown street markets, Mt. Faber’s panoramic
view, and the Botanical Gardens with their rare
orchids. The rest of the afternoon is yours to
enjoy. (B)
DAY 5: SINGAPORE
Today a tour of the Jurong Bird Park awaits us - one
of the largest aviaries in the world. The rest of
the day is at leisure. You may want to squeeze in a
visit to the Raffles Hotel made famous by Rudyard
Kipling, Joseph Conrad and W. Somerset Maugham for
one of their famous Singapore Slings! This evening,
there will be a dinner show with a display of
cultural dancers from several Asian countries. (B,D)
DAY 6: SINGAPORE - BANGKOK
Upon arrival in Bangkok, after settling in at our
hotel we will experience a host of romantic and
exotic images. We will venture back in time to the
ancient kingdom of Siam, now Thailand served as the
setting for the musical “The King and I”. We will
find magnificent palaces, temples and ancient
artifacts that have been well preserved. A welcome
reception will await us at the hotel. (B, Inflight)
DAY 7: BANGKOK
This morning we will tour Bangkok and three of its
most ornate and exotic temples: Wat Trimitr - with
its invaluable Golden Buddha (5 1/2 tons of gold!);
Wat Po - a temple built to adorn its colossal
Reclining Buddha, and Wat Benchamabophit - a
classical marble temple. This afternoon is at your
leisure to explore the city on your own or simply
relax. Spend your evening enjoying a genuine Thai
style dinner in a delightful Thai atmosphere
accompanied by Thai classical music and dances. The
dancers with their beautiful glittering costumes and
graceful rhythm will stay in your memory forever. (B,D)
DAY 8: BANGKOK
This morning will begin with a tour of one of the
most spectacular places in the world, the Grand
Palace, formerly the seat of the court of Old Siam.
Built by King Rama I, it houses one of the world’s
most venerated Buddha images, the Emerald Buddha.
This afternoon we will enjoy a rice barge/sunset
cruise that will take us through winding waterways
to see the villages. Enjoy unlimited drinks, snacks
and fruit along our passage. Dinner is included
tonight. (B,D)
DAY 9: BANGKOK
Today will take us to the Floating Market of Damnoen
Saduak, which provides a glimpse of local trading
practices. The tour will continue to Nakorn Pathom,
the highest Pagoda in Southeast Asia. Lunch is
included at the picturesque Rose Garden where we
will be entertained and educated while learning Thai
customs at the Thai Village Show. (B,L)
DAY 10: BANGKOK - HONG KONG
We will depart this morning bound for the remarkable
British Crown Colony of Hong Kong. Known as the
‘Pearl of the Orient”, Hong Kong possesses Asia’s
most spectacular harbor and its best shopping
opportunities. Arriving in Hong Kong in the
afternoon we will have the rest of the day free to
get our first glimpses of this dynamic city. (B,Inflight
meals)
DAY 11: HONG KONG
Our morning tour of Kowloon & Hong Kong includes
visits to Aberdeen; where the “Water People” of Hong
Kong live aboard fishing junks; beautiful Repulse
Bay, Tiger Balm Gardens and Victoria Peak with its
panoramic harbor view. (B)
DAY 12: HONG KONG
Since this is our last full day in Hong Kong, you
may choose to enjoy shopping at the famous Stanley
Market, which is the home of designer labels at
bargain prices, or just relax and absorb the
atmosphere of this fascinating city! This evening we
will enjoy a dinner at the famous Jumbo Floating
Restaurant, the largest floating restaurant in the
world. (B,D)
DAY 13: HONG KONG - USA
We will awaken to our final breakfast of the tour
and take care of last minute shopping before we
transfer to the airport for our return to the United
States. (B,Inflight meals) |
